A little metatarsal pad advice
The location of the metatarsal pad is somewhat a matter of personal comfort. Because the self-adhesive backing is very effective, it is a good idea to experiment first using double-sided sticky tape before removing the adhesive backing.
Adjusting the thermo-plastic (polypropylene) longitudinal arch
Pedag® insoles with thermo-plastic (polypropylene) footbeds include: VIVA®, VIVA® HIGH, VIVA® OUTDOOR, VIVA® SUMMER, VIVA®SNEAKER, VIVA® MINI, VIVA® WINTER, VIVA® SPORT and HOLIDAY. The longitudinal arch area of all these insoles can be heat molded and adjusted to your specific arch height. Adjusting the arch is usually unnecessary. The vast majority of Pedag® customers never need to change the height of the arch.
However, if you wish to raise or lower the arch you can use the following procedure:
- Warm only the longitudinal arch area of the polypropylene orthotic foot-bed using a hair dryer or heat gun.
- When the polypropylene unit is warm it will become pliable. It should NOT be so hot that your skin is uncomfortable in any way.
- Using your thumbs, make small adjustments-raising or lowering the arch a few millimeters at a time.
- Try the orthotic after each adjustment and see if it feels right. If one foot has a higher or lower arch than the other foot, each insole can be adjusted differently. Whatever is most comfortable is fine.
- Once you think you have found the correct height, wear the insole for a few hours and see if you are satisfied.
- If you are not satisfied and want to try again, repeat the above steps.
Should I put pedag® orthotics underneath or on top of the shoe manufacturer's insole?
Most pedag® orthotic items are very low profile so they can fit into a variety of footwear. When there is too much room in the shoe, full length pedag® orthotics should be placed ON TOP of the shoe manufacturer's insole.
